AbstractThe main purpose of this study is to construct and validate a questionnaire to assess the social communication skills of students of Amin University of Law Enforcement Sciences. The present study is of applied-developmental type and in terms of quantitative methods of data collection is descriptive-survey type. In order to obtain formal validity, CVR and CVI indices were estimated using experts. The reliability of the questionnaire was assessed using the internal consistency method. The population of the present study was all undergraduate and graduate students approved by Amin University of Law Enforcement Sciences, from which they were selected by relative class sampling method (397 people). The results of factor analysis of confirmatory data in the form of measurement model after providing all the assumptions showed that out of 195 items identified for social communication skills, 131 items were correlated with their components (9 components) and were approved as the final questions of the questionnaire. Investigating the Impacts of Farsi-language Satellite Network Programs on Family Breakdown (Case Study of Tehran City) Gafar Hossin Pour[1] , Reza Abdolrahmany[2] , Rasol Alizadeh[3] Receive: 25/4/2018 Accept: 2018/6/24 Abstract The tendency to watch satellite programs, establish networks and broadcast programs in Persian through these networks has been a wave of concerns over the past year on increasing social harm, especially family-related harm. Accordingly, the social analysis and analysis of the effects of these programs on the failure of families in Tehran (apart from all other effective factors on family breakdown) is the main objective of this paper. The theoretical framework include the theory of dependency, the theory of uses and satisfactions, and finally the theory of planting in the field of communication and media. this research applies analytical-descriptive survey type. The method of collecting the field information and its tool is a researcher made questionnaire. A sample of 137 people from the Farsi-language satellite network program is randomly selected among those who are in some way involved with the issue of disputes, tensions, and family-related complaints, and some of them have referred to the court for this reason. The validity of the questionnaire was obtained by using its rationale and its reliability through Cronbach's alpha (alpha coefficient total 0/894). The results of the research indicate that there is a relationship between watching Persian-language programs of satellite networks and families of families in Tehran. In addition, the results of the research show that Persian-language satellite programs that promote illegal relationships, such as: serials that promote free sexual relations directly and indirectly, affect breakdown of families.
